The Wave Motion Apparatus – 24 Pulleys is a high-resolution mechanical demonstrator designed for the empirical study of wave mechanics, phase relationships, and the propagation of energy through a medium. Optimized for Secondary and Collegiate STEM curricula, this enhanced version offers a higher density of oscillation points (24 vertical rods) compared to standard models, providing a smoother and more detailed visualization of sine wave behavior. Key Pedagogical Outcomes (Bloom’s Taxonomy Alignment)
- High-Resolution Wave Interface -> Facilitates student visualization of complex wave forms with 24 data points, providing a more fluid representation of energy propagation, supporting Physics Module 102 (Understanding).
- Rotary-to-Linear Modeling -> Enables the physical study of how circular movement converts into simple harmonic motion (SHM) in a vertical plane (Applying).
- Phase Angle Analysis -> Supports the Analysis of phase differences between adjacent particles using the integrated 360° rotational scale to map rod height to angular position.
- Complex Waveform Evaluation -> Allows students to Evaluate the physical properties of ripples, vibrating strings, and sound compressions by observing the specific movement of the rod tips and eight specialized transverse rods (Evaluating).
